Topic:Pharmacology

Pharmacology in horses involves the study and application of drugs and medications to diagnose, treat, and prevent diseases and conditions in equine species. This field encompasses the understanding of pharmacokinetics and pharmacodynamics specific to horses, including how drugs are absorbed, distributed, metabolized, and excreted by the equine body. Commonly studied pharmacological agents in horses include non-steroidal anti-inflammatory drugs (NSAIDs), antibiotics, sedatives, and anthelmintics. Research in equine pharmacology focuses on determining appropriate dosages, understanding drug interactions, and minimizing adverse effects.
